Jonas 3

1 And the word of the LORD came untoThis is a great declaration of God's mercy, that he receives him again, and sends him forth as his Prophet, who had before shown such great weakness.Jonah the second time, saying,

2 Arise, goe vnto Nineueh that great citie, & preach vnto it the preaching, which I bid thee.

3 So Jonah arose, and went unto Nineveh, according to the word of the LORD. Now Nineveh was an exceeding{{See Jon_1:2}}great city of three days' journey.

4 And Jonah began to enter into the city a day'sHe went forward one day in the city and preached, and so he continued until the city was converted.journey, and he cried, and said, Yet forty days, and Nineveh shall be overthrown.

5 So the people of NinevehFor he declared that he was a Prophet sent to them from God, to make known his judgments against them.believed God, and proclaimed a fast, and put on sackcloth, from the greatest of them even to the least of them.

6 For worde came vnto the King of Nineueh, and he rose from his throne, and he layed his robe from him, and couered him with sackecloth, and sate in ashes.

7 And he caused [it] to be proclaimed and published through Nineveh by the decree of the king and his nobles, saying, Let neither man norNot that the dumb beasts had sinned or could repent, but that by their example man might be astonished, considering that for his sin the anger of God hung over all creatures.beast, herd nor flock, taste any thing: let them not feed, nor drink water:

8 But let man and beast be covered with sackcloth, andHe exhorted that the men should earnestly call to God for mercy.cry mightily unto God: yea, let them turn every one from his evil way, and from the violence that [is] in their hands.

9 For partly from the threatening of the prophet, and partly from his own conscience, he doubted whether God would show them mercy.Who can tell [if] God will turn and repent, and turn away from his fierce anger, that we perish not?

10 And God saw theirThat is, the fruits of their repentance, which proceeded from faith, which God had planted by the ministry of his Prophet.works, that they turned from their evil way; and{{See Jer_18:8}}God repented of the evil, that he had said that he would do unto them; and he did [it] not.
